The hatchback was built on a modified MQB modular chassis, which underlies the new compact models of the Volkswagen concern. The Scala is smaller than the Skoda Octavia. Length 4362 mm, width - 1793 mm, height - 1471 mm, wheelbase - 2649 mm.

A swift appearance is not an optical illusion and is not only associated with a Czech arrow. The new Czech hatchback is truly aerodynamic. Many people compare this model with Audi. The drag coefficient of the Scala is 0,29. Beautiful triangular headlights, a powerful enough radiator grille. And the smooth lines of the new Skoda make the car more attractive.

The Scala was also the first Skoda model to have a large brand name on the rear instead of a small emblem. Almost like a Porsche. And if the exterior of the Skoda Scala reminds someone of a Seat Leon, then inside there are more associations with Audi.

Interior

At first it seems that the car is small, but if you get into the salon, you will be surprised - the car is spacious and comfortable. So, the legroom is, like in the Octavia 73 mm, the rear space is slightly less (1425 versus 1449 millimeters), and more overhead (982 versus 980 millimeters). But in addition to the largest passenger space in the class, the Scala also has the largest trunk in the class - 467 liters. And if you fold the backs of the rear seats, it will be 1410 liters.

The machine is equipped with interesting technological innovations. The Skoda Scala has the same Virtual Cockpit as the one that first appeared on the Audi Q7. It offers the driver a choice of five different pictures. From the classic dashboard with a speedometer and a tachometer in the form of round dials, and different backlighting in the Basic, Modern and Sport modes. To the map from the Amundsen navigation system in full screen.

In addition, Skoda Scala became the first Czech-made golf class hatchback to distribute the Internet itself. Scala already has built-in eSIM with LTE connectivity. Therefore, passengers have a high-speed Internet connection without an additional SIM card or smartphone.

The car can have up to 9 airbags, including the driver’s knee airbag and, for the first time in the segment, additional rear side airbags. And the Crew Protect Assist passenger protection system automatically closes the windows and tightens the front seat belts in the event of a potential collision.

Engine

Skoda Scala offers its customers 5 powertrains to choose from. These included: gasoline and diesel turbo engines, as well as a methane-powered propulsion system. The base engine 1.0 TSI (95 forces) is paired with a 5-speed "mechanics". The 115-strong version of this engine, 1.5 TSI (150 forces) and 1.6 TDI (115 forces) are offered with a 6-speed "mechanics" or 7-speed "robot" DSG. The 90-horsepower 1.0 G-TEC, powered by natural gas, is offered with only 6MKPP.

On road

The suspension absorbs bumps very effectively. The steering is fast and accurate, and the ride is noble and graceful. It enters into the turns of the car very smoothly.

On the road, Skoda Skala 2019 behaves with dignity, and you do not notice that it has a small platform. Despite its size, Scala 2019 does not share architecture with the SEAT Leon or Volkswagen Golf. The Czech model uses the Volkswagen Group's MQB-A0 platform, i.e. the same as the Seat Ibiza or Volkswagen Polo.

The interior is very high quality soundproofed. The console has a button that allows you to select driving modes. There are four of them (Normal, Sport, Eco and Individual) and allow you to change the throttle response, steering, automatic transmission and suspension stiffness. This change in damping is possible if the Scala 2019 uses Sports Chassis, an optional suspension that reduces body height by 15 mm and offers electronically adjustable shock absorbers. This, in our opinion, is not worth it, because in sports mode it becomes less comfortable, and maneuverability basically remains the same.
